What is CVE-2026-84671?

The Jenkins File Parameter Plugin, specifically version 425.v3fa_801681b_5e and earlier, contains a vulnerability that permits attackers to write files to arbitrary locations on the Jenkins controller file system. This weakness arises from improper data binding through the Stapler framework, potentially leading to unauthorized remote code execution. Organizations using this plugin should prioritize reviewing their systems and applying necessary updates to mitigate possible security risks.
